Solution Overview
Problem
Retail stores face challenges in enhancing the shopping experience for customers, including items being hard to find on shelves, customers not noticing matching products, reluctance to ask for assistance, and difficulty in finding suitable items, despite personalized approaches and advertisements.
Innovation Solution
A system that uses beacons and RFID readers in dressing rooms to communicate with customers' mobile devices, providing location and item information, suggesting complementary products, and allowing for personalized service without disturbing other shoppers, enabling efficient and targeted marketing.

Data Source
AI summary
Methods and systems for improving a shopping experience are described. A customer brings items of clothing to try on in a dressing room. The customer's exact location is provided to the store clerk with the assistance of a beacon located in the dressing room. The store clerk also knows the exact items the customer has brought into the dressing room because a reader in the dressing room reads tags associated with the items. The customer may be provided with information on suggested products, such as alternative or complementary items to the items the customer selected.
